MUMBAI, India, June 22 -- Intellectual Property India has published a patent application (202641051219 A) filed by Maithreyan S; Lohith A; Nithessvaren Elumalai; Kavya A; Manoj Bala V; Karan S; and Jasmine Mystica K on April 22, 2026, for Design Of Hazbot: An Esp32 Based Disaster Containment System.

Inventors include Maithreyan S; Lohiith A; Nithessvaren Elumalai; Kavya A; Manoj Bala V; Karan S; and Jasmine Mystica K.

The application for the patent was published on June 12, 2026, under issue no. 24/2026.

Abstract: This project presents HAZBot, a robotic system designed for disaster management and hazardous environment exploration. Built using an ESP32 microcontroller, the robot is equipped with environmental sensors to detect and monitor dangerous conditions in areas that are unsafe for human responders. To ensure reliable operation during emergencies, HAZBot utilizes GPS for accurate location tracking and LoRa technology for long-range communication, allowing it to transmit data even when standard cellular networks fail. By providing critical, real-time environmental data and location tracking to rescue teams, HAZBot improves situational awareness, aids in search and rescue efforts, and enhances the overall safety of first responders during critical operations
